ELECTRICITY SERVICE NORTH TEXAS VA HEALTHCARE SYSTEM is a federal award for 257-Network Contract Office 17 (36C257) held by Engie Resources LLC. Estimated value $5M ($5M obligated). Current period of performance ends Jun 30, 2026. Place of performance: DALLAS TX.
